Tesco

Tesco is an international supermarket chain. It offers a wide range of products. It is among the largest chains in UK and has more than 3700 stores. The stores vary from megastores to smaller stores. It also offers online shopping and home delivery. It is also committed to offering its customers low prices each day. It also offers loyalty discounts on certain products.

Tesco was established in 1919 by Jack Cohen, who set up a small stall in London’s East End. The idea was to let people choose their own items. It was a huge success and he expanded his business. He began selling goods to other businesses.

The company has expanded its business to include books, clothes and electronics, furniture and financial services. Its stores include huge hypermarkets, discount stores and convenience stores. Its supermarkets offer a variety of fresh products including meat, dairy bakery, frozen foods, and ready-to-eat meals. They also stock cosmetics, toiletries, and cleaning products.

Tesco launched its first US stores in 2007 under the name Fresh & Easy. The company had hoped to create a coast to coast business and constructed a costly infrastructure. Tesco announced in 2013 that it was leaving the United States.

The decision to pull out of the US market was based on careful consideration and extensive study. Tesco has invested more than $1 billion in its US operations. The company also worked for 20 years on a move into the American market. It recruited Dunhumby as a customer-science company and sent its executives to American homes to observe what families consumed and where they went to shop.
